The seminar is intended for FIE Standard and Basic trainers who received their Trainer-2 diploma in 2020 or earlier, though it is open to all graduates of Trainer-2 courses.
Participation in this seminar fulfills one of the requirements of the Feuerstein trainers’ re-certification process.
Candidates are expected to submit evidence of their training experience in the form of an FIE training report (obtained from the Feuerstein Institute) by September 11, 2026.
Seminar Syllabus
- Components of IE training and implementation
- In-depth analysis of the Feuerstein theory
- Didactics of MLE theory training
- Didactics of IE tasks training
- Didactics of IE lesson planning
- “Bridging” to different subject areas
- Principles and techniques of coaching new IE teachers
- Techniques of IE lesson observation
- Training and supervision documentation and reporting
- Ethical and professional standards in IE training and program implementation
- Introduction to the digital versions of Standard and Basic instruments
Participants will be required to make a presentation reflecting their IE training experience.
Certification
Course participants will be awarded a Certificate of Instrumental Enrichment Trainer Renewal upon successful completion of the entire course requirements.
The certificate is valid for six years from its issue date and serves as an IE Training license. Its renewal is dependent on:
- Submission of standard training reports (as specified by the ATA agreement) or proper reporting of the courses taught by you in the annual report of the ATC (as stipulated in the ATC contract)
- Completion of a Trainer’s Renewal Course once every six years, given in the annual Feuerstein Summer Workshops
Trainers must either sign an agreement with the Feuerstein Institute establishing themselves as an ATA/ATC or be employed by an existing ATC. Trainers are forbidden from teaching the Feuerstein Method without having an existing contract in place.
